摘要
We show that several types of global strings occur in color superconducting quark matter due to the spontaneous violation of relevant U(1) symmetries. These include the baryon U(1)(B), and approximate axial U(1)(A) symmetries as well as an approximate U(1)(S) arising from kaon condensation. We discuss some general properties of these strings and their interactions. In particular, we demonstrate that the U(1)(A) strings behave as superconducting strings. We draw some parallels between these strings and global cosmological strings and discuss some possible implications of these strings to the physics in neutron star cores.
